The main focus of this research is the role of informal leadership in regional development. The method used is qualitative by using descriptive, and data obtained using literature study methods of the journals of previous research results in various regions in Indonesia. Data obtained by searching online in Google Scholar database. Research results show that the role of informal leaders in development is needed by local communities, especially those who have a system of cultural values and local wisdom that are still strong. Therefore, areas where there are still communities that have local wisdom in the form of informal leaders can be used as a resource in their regional development
